Fråga: Hur ansluter jag Unix-skalskript till databasen?

Hur ansluter man till en databas i UNIX-skalskript?

Det första du måste göra för att ansluta till oracle-databasen i unix-maskinen är att installera oracle-databasdrivrutiner på unix-boxen. När du har installerat, testa om du kan ansluta till databasen från kommandotolken eller inte. Om du kan ansluta till databasen går allt bra.

Hur ansluter jag MySQL-databas till Unix-skalskript?

# MYSQL CONFIG VARIABLES $platform = “mysql”; $host = " ”; $database = " ”; $org_table = " ”; $user = " ”; $pw = " ”; # DATAKÄLLAN NAMN $dsn = “dbi:$plattform:$databas:$host:$port”; # PERL DBI CONNECT $connect = DBI->connect($dsn, $user, $pw);

Hur kör jag ett skalskript i MySQL?

Låt oss börja med att köra en enda MySQL-fråga från kommandoraden:

  1. Syntax: …
  2. -u : fråga efter MySQL-databasanvändarnamn.
  3. -p : fråga efter lösenord.
  4. -e : fråga efter fråga du vill köra. …
  5. Så här kontrollerar du alla tillgängliga databaser: …
  6. Kör MySQL-fråga på kommandoraden på distans med -h-alternativet:

28 juli. 2016 г.

Hur kör jag ett SQL-skript från Unix-kommandoraden?

Köra ett skript när du startar SQL*Plus

  1. Följ kommandot SQLPLUS med ditt användarnamn, ett snedstreck, ett mellanslag, @ och namnet på filen: SQLPLUS HR @SALES. SQL*Plus startar, frågar efter ditt lösenord och kör skriptet.
  2. Inkludera ditt användarnamn som den första raden i filen. Följ kommandot SQLPLUS med @ och filnamnet.

Vad är skalskript i Unix?

Ett skalskript är ett datorprogram designat för att köras av Unix-skalet, en kommandoradstolk. De olika dialekterna av skalskript anses vara skriptspråk. Typiska operationer som utförs av skalskript inkluderar filmanipulering, programkörning och utskrift av text.

Vad är spool in shell script?

Använder Oracle spool-kommandot

Kommandot "spool" används inom SQL*Plus för att styra utdata från valfri fråga till en platt fil på serversidan. SQL> spool /tmp/myfile.lst. Eftersom spoolkommandot gränssnitt med OS-lagret, används spoolkommandot vanligtvis i Oracle-skalskript.

Vad är MySQL-skal?

MySQL Shell är en avancerad klient och kodredigerare för MySQL. Det här dokumentet beskriver kärnfunktionerna i MySQL Shell. Utöver den tillhandahållna SQL-funktionaliteten, liknande mysql, tillhandahåller MySQL Shell skriptfunktioner för JavaScript och Python och inkluderar API:er för att arbeta med MySQL.

Hur tilldelar man utdata från en SQL-fråga till en Unix-variabel?

I det första kommandot tilldelar du utdata från kommandot datum i variabeln "var"! $() eller “ betyder att tilldela kommandots utdata. Och i det andra kommandot skriver du ut värdet för variabeln "var". Nu till din SQL-fråga.

Vilka är kommandona i MySQL?

MySQL-kommandon

  • SELECT — extraherar data från en databas. …
  • UPPDATERING — uppdaterar data i en databas. …
  • DELETE — tar bort data från en databas. …
  • INSERT INTO — infogar ny data i en databas. …
  • SKAPA DATABAS — skapar en ny databas. …
  • ALTER DATABASE — ändrar en databas. …
  • SKAPA TABELL — skapar en ny tabell. …
  • ALTER TABLE — ändrar en tabell.

Hur kan jag se MySQL-databasen?

Visa MySQL-databaser

Det vanligaste sättet att få en lista över MySQL-databaserna är att använda mysql-klienten för att ansluta till MySQL-servern och köra kommandot SHOW DATABASES. Om du inte har ställt in ett lösenord för din MySQL-användare kan du utelämna -p-omkopplaren.

Hur kör jag flera SQL-satser i skalskript?

sh-skript för att köra flera MySQL-kommandon. mysql -h$host -u$user -p$password -e "släpp databasen $dbname;" mysql -h$host -u$user -p$password -e "skapa databas $dbname;" mysql -h$host -u$user -p$password -e "ett annat MySQL-kommando" ...

Hur öppnar jag MySQL-skalet i Linux?

På Linux startar du mysql med kommandot mysql i ett terminalfönster.
.
Kommandot mysql

  1. -h följt av serverns värdnamn (csmysql.cs.cf.ac.uk)
  2. -u följt av kontots användarnamn (använd ditt MySQL-användarnamn)
  3. -p som säger åt mysql att fråga efter ett lösenord.
  4. databas namnet på databasen (använd ditt databasnamn).

Hur kör jag ett skript från SQLPlus-kommandoraden?

Svar: För att köra en skriptfil i SQLPlus, skriv @ och sedan filnamnet. Kommandot ovan förutsätter att filen finns i den aktuella katalogen. (dvs: den aktuella katalogen är vanligtvis den katalog som du befann dig i innan du startade SQLPlus.) Detta kommando skulle köra en skriptfil som heter script.

Hur kör jag ett SQL-skript i Linux-terminalen?

Vänligen följ stegen nedan.

  1. Öppna Terminal och skriv mysql -u för att öppna MySQL-kommandoraden.
  2. Skriv sökvägen till din mysql bin-katalog och tryck på Enter.
  3. Klistra in din SQL-fil i bin-mappen på mysql-servern.
  4. Skapa en databas i MySQL.
  5. Använd just den databasen där du vill importera SQL-filen.

Hur kör jag ett SQL-skript?

Köra ett SQL-skript från SQL-skriptsidan

  1. På Workspace-hemsidan klickar du på SQL Workshop och sedan på SQL-skript. …
  2. I listan Visa väljer du Detaljer och klickar på Gå. …
  3. Klicka på ikonen Kör för det skript du vill köra. …
  4. Sidan Kör skript visas. …
  5. Klicka på Kör för att skicka skriptet för körning.
Gilla det här inlägget? Dela gärna med dina vänner:
OS idag